What is Duo Security?
Duo Security is a cloud-based access security provider that protects the workforce from breaches, cyberattacks, and account takeovers.
How does Duo Security work?
Duo Security verifies the identities of users and the security posture of their devices before granting access to applications. This is done through multi-factor authentication, device visibility and access policies.
What is multi-factor authentication?
Multi-factor authentication is a security process that requires users to provide two or more forms of identification before accessing a system or application. Duo Security offers several methods of authentication, including push notifications, SMS passcodes, phone calls, and hardware tokens.
What is device visibility?
Device visibility is the ability to see and manage the security posture of all devices that access your organization's applications. Duo Security provides real-time visibility into the security health of all devices and enables administrators to enforce access policies based on device security posture.
What are access policies?
Access policies are rules that determine who can access what applications and under what circumstances. Duo Security enables administrators to set granular access policies based on user roles, device security posture, location, and more.
What is the Duo Access Gateway?
The Duo Access Gateway is a software solution that enables organizations to add two-factor authentication to any web-based or cloud application, without requiring any changes to the application itself. It supports SSO and integrates with all major identity providers.
What is the Duo Trusted Access Report?
The Duo Trusted Access Report is a quarterly publication that provides insights into the state of device security and access policies across organizations. It includes data from millions of devices and provides benchmarks and best practices for securing access to applications.
What is the Duo Community?
The Duo Community is a forum for Duo Security customers and partners to share knowledge, ask questions, and get help with Duo Security products and services. It includes a knowledge base, discussion forums, and a customer support portal.

What is OneLogin?
OneLogin is a cloud-based identity and access management (IAM) solution that enables enterprises to secure all apps, devices, and users.
What are the benefits of using OneLogin?
OneLogin provides a range of benefits, including improved security, increased productivity, reduced IT costs, and simplified compliance.
What types of authentication does OneLogin support?
OneLogin supports a range of authentication methods, including single sign-on (SSO), multi-factor authentication (MFA), and passwordless authentication.
What integrations does OneLogin offer?
OneLogin offers integrations with a wide range of applications, including Microsoft Office 365, Salesforce, Workday, and G Suite, among others.
How does OneLogin ensure security?
OneLogin uses a range of security measures, including encryption, multi-factor authentication, and threat detection, to ensure the security of user identities and data.
What support options are available for OneLogin?
OneLogin offers a range of support options, including phone, email, and chat support, as well as an online knowledge base and community forum.
